>>172568779
Pixel perfect hitboxes can be unpredictible if the sprite size changes with animation. A box collider at the center of the sprite, slightly smaller than the sprite, is the most forgiving hitbox.

>>172579784

I'd recommend... not having plot twists.

Plot twists are usually pretty divisive. They're either loved or hated. If your plot twist is obvious and predictable, it has no impact. If it's not obvious, it can feel totally irrelevant and out of left field (like Braid, for instance).

The biggest driving force in any story will always be characters. Likeable and enjoyable characters will drive a story.

Why do you remember Star Wars? It's the characters. The actual "plot" of Star Wars is basic as heck. You remember Luke, you remember Han Solo.

Start with the characters. Always. Then build the story around them.

>>172579784
>unforeseeable plot twists
this is automatically bad writing, plot is like a good game where each previous action has consequences, plot twists are the confluence of these various actions into an event. they are unexpected not because they are unforeseeable but because there were many alternative foreseeable outcomes that viewer expected more or the viewer missed/ignored important clues that related to the outcome.
easily one of the most important aspects of satisfying storytelling is foreshadowing - learn it, live it, love it.

>>172590150
Some pointers: Mesh.Combine() can be used for all your trees and other props to reduce draw calls and GameObjects in the scene. 1000 was the upper limit of gameobjects a few years back. You can get better with newer hardware but 1000 is a good upper target to shoot for.

>>172592461
You can implement scene graphs in a cache-friendly way. All you do is have all the nodes in an array, where children come after their parents. You then iterate through the array once to do all your transformations, and the children can depend on their transformed parents since you're guaranteed to have processed them already.

>>172651569
>>172652293
Why make a skybox in another program when you can do it in engine? Then you don't need to worry about warping artifacts or getting it to fit with the rest of the scene with lighting and such, and you can make it dynamic.
